A-PAL NEWSLETTER (ALBANIAN PRISONER ADVOCACY)
April 18, 2001
RELEASE BEDRI KUKALAJ AND KUMRIE VOCAJ!
At this point, it seems that all those were to be released from
Serbian prisons under the Amnesty Law have arrived home. This leaves
approximately 70 to 80 political prisoners, many of them from the
Rahovec area, arrested in 1998. There are also about 100 prisoners
detained on criminal charges from before the NATO war. We hope and
expect that the 143 Gjakova prisoners will be released soon after
their appeal in the Serb Supreme Court April 23-26.
Until now, we did not advocate for the release of specific prisoners.
But now that approach seems useful. There are certain cases we feel
that warrant immediate action.

1. Kumrie Vocaj-age 22. Female prisoner in Pozharevac Prison.
Arrested at age 14 in 1992, imprisoned for eight years, she has never
been on trial. She has had no family contact. She should be released
immediately.
2. Bedri Kukalaj-age 23. Sentenced to 10 yrs. for terrorism. Shot in
the head at the Dubrava Massacre in May, 1999, shattering his jaw and
eye. He has had two operations, but has sent a desperate plea for
release. He is in Belgrade Prison. Periodically has to receive IV
treatment because he is unable to eat. He fears for his life. He
should be released immediately for humanitarian reasons.
Other individual cases that warrant dismissal-
1. Bekim Kastrati-age 33. Worked for OSCE in Prishtina. Arrested 3
days after the NATO war began. Sentenced to 14 yrs. for terrorism.
The EU wrote asking for his release on 11/16/00. He is in Prokuplje
Prison.
2. Luan and Bekim Mazreku-cousins. Nish Prison. Both in Dubrava
Massacre. Now on trial but arrested in 1998. How can anyone provide a
fair trial to those persons who they tried to massacre? Are they
innocent until proven guilty? Or guilty until proven innocent?
3. Ismet Berbati-age 31. Peje. Father of five. In Dubrava Massacre.
Arrested in 1998. Investigated but never tried.
4. Nexhat Brahimi-age 27, In very poor health. Nish Prison. No sentence?
5. Naim Haziraj-age 29. Arrested in 1998. Zajecar Prison. No sentence?
6. Albin Kurti-age 26. Convicted without evidence. Irregular trial.
Sentenced to 15 yrs. Dismissal recommended by Yugoslav Lawyers for
Human Rights on April 4, 2001.
7. Besim Zymberi-age 33. In Dubrava Massacre. Poor health. Belgrade
Prison. Sentenced to 14 yrs.

DUBRAVA MASSACRE SURVIVORS STILL IN PRISON:
1. Nait Hasani-age 36. Wounded badly. Sentenced to 20 yrs.
2. Xhavit Kolgeci-age 27. Sentenced to 11 yrs. Nish Prison.
3. Milazim Kolgeci-age 40. Sentenced to 12 yrs. Nish Prison.
4. Aslan Lumi-age 48. Sentenced to 12 yrs. Nish Prison.
5. Besim Rama-age 36. Sentenced to 20 yrs. Nish Prison.
6. Ismet Berbati-age 31. No trial. Nish Prison.
7. Besim Zymberi-age 33. Sentenced to 14 yrs. Belgrade Prison.
8. Agim Recica-age 38. Sentenced to 13 yrs. Belgrade Prison.
9. Ejup Salihu-age 27. Sentenced to 5 yrs. Belgrade Prison.
10. Luan Mazreku-age 23. Still on trial. Nish Prison.
11. Bekim Mazreku-age 23. Still on trial. Nish Prison.
12. Idriz Asllani- age 48. Sentenced to 15 yrs. Location unknown.
13. Bedri Kukalaj-age 23. Sentenced to 10 yrs. Belgrade Prison.
The Dubrava Massacre took place near Istok, Kosova, May 21-23, 1999.
The ICTY investigation on this massacre will be out in a few months.
Hopefully these prisoners will be free when that happens.
